Output 85c81c5bb8d6ebf3a56a8eb38fac9da07ab70fd0da25957b944f967cefc775bc:9

value
208306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51ccb94f7ef1c27915332971df09a26e7ce70cd OP_EQUAL
address
3Q33yGeqMdNM6mSDdXbLf5uzKbyoEnb3Wt
transaction
85c81c5bb8d6ebf3a56a8eb38fac9da07ab70fd0da25957b944f967cefc775bc
confirmations
144071
spent
true